Island Day at Bestival

Thursday, 16th April, 2009 at 9:55 am, Isle of Wight

Bestival, Central Wight, Music

Island Day at BestivalEvery year at Bestival although there’s always a great selection of Island music, we’ve always wondered why the Bestival team don’t make more of the fact that the Isle of Wight is a hotbed for musical talent.

Well this year, it seems, our thoughts are turning into a reality.

We hear that this September, the entire Saturday lineup on the Bandstand will be a magnificent celebration of the Isle of Wight’s own incredible musical talent, dubbed Island Day.

Explaining the idea behind Island Day, Rob da Bank said:

“Each year I get inundated with CDs of amazing bands and DJs from the Island and I can never fit enough on so this year we’re giving the whole of the Saturday day and night on the Bandstand over to Isle Of Wight talent. From Blank Beats to The Shutes, we’ve got the cream of the local bands and watch out for an announcement on a DJ day too.”

This is fabulous news for Island bands confirmed to play, as anyone watching on will be fully aware of where the band originate.

This is also a great coup for Island tourism – we’ve been banging on about the Island music scene being a great asset for Island tourism for ages, so hopefully Island Day will be publicised, promoted and celebrated by all.
